Comprehending the Italian Driving License

Italy's driving license system is governed by European Union regulations, meaning that all member states have similar standards. There are different categories of licenses depending upon the kind of vehicle to be driven, such as:

  • Category A: Motorcycles
  • Category B: Cars
  • Category C: Trucks
  • Category D: Buses
  • Classification E: Trailers

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How long does it take to obtain an Italian driving license?

The time needed can differ substantially based upon private scenarios. On average, candidates can anticipate the process to take anywhere from a few weeks to numerous months, depending upon available screening dates and preparation time.

Q2: Can I utilize a foreign driving license in Italy?

Yes, EU driving licenses are normally accepted in Italy. For non-EU licenses, you might require to transform your license to an Italian one, particularly if you prepare to remain in Italy for more than a year.
